How do i get an e zpass mailed to me?

To get an E-ZPass mailed to you, you'll need to follow these steps:

  1. Check if you're eligible: E-ZPass is available in several states, including New York,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Delaware, Maryland, Virginia, and Massachusetts. Make sure you're eligible to use E-ZPass in your state.
  2. Choose your toll authority: Each state has its own toll authority that manages E-ZPass. For example, in New York, it's the New York State Thruway Authority, while in New Jersey, it's the New Jersey Turnpike Authority. Find the toll authority for your state.
  3. Apply online: Visit the website of your state's toll authority and look for the "Apply for E-ZPass" or "Get an E-ZPass" section. Fill out the online application form, which will ask for your personal and vehicle information.
  4. Provide required documents: You may need to upload or mail in proof of insurance, vehicle registration, and identification. Check the toll authority's website for specific requirements.
  5. Pay the application fee: You'll need to pay a one-time application fee, which varies by state. This fee is usually non-refundable.
  6. Wait for your E-ZPass: Once your application is processed, your E-ZPass will be mailed to you. This may take a few days to a week, depending on the toll authority's processing time.
  7. Activate your E-ZPass: Once you receive your E-ZPass, you'll need to activate it by calling the toll authority's customer service number or visiting their website.
